Author Information

Dan Kainen is an artist, designer, and inventor living in New York City. He is the creator of the bestselling Photicular books, including Safari, Ocean, Polar, Jungle, and Wild. While working with some of the pioneers of holography, Dan created a special spotlight that was used by Soho's Museum of Holography to light holograms. The related field of holography led to Dan's interest in lenticular art and, in turn, after nearly a decade of research and experimentation, to the creation of his ""Motion Viewer,"" his third patent in that field and the inspiration for Safari and the other Photicular books. Visit him at DanKainen.com. Mara Grunbaum is a science writer and editor who's covered everything from the biology of whiskers to mining palladium on the moon. Her work has appeared in Popular Science, Discover magazine, OnEarth, ScientificAmerican.com, and other publications and websites. She is a graduate of New York University's master's program in Science, Health, and Environmental Reporting, and lives in Brooklyn, New York.
